Sabres, Red Wings Highlight Tonight's Playoff Action
12th April, 2007 - 5:42 pm
Yahoo.com - The Sabres enjoyed their best regular season in franchise history. Now they will try to carry over that success to the postseason.

The Sabres begin their playoff run Thursday when they host the Islanders in the Eastern Conference quarterfinals.

In the Western Conference, the top-seeded Red Wings, who tied the Sabres with 113 points during the regular season, take on the eighth-seeded Flames in the opener of their quarterfinal series.
